As nouns, adherence and adhesion are synonyms defined as:
  • adherence and adhesion: faithful support for a cause or political party or religion
Other synonyms of adherence include attachment.
As nouns, adherence and adhesion are synonyms defined as:
  • adherence and adhesion: the property of sticking together (as of glue and wood) or the joining of surfaces of different composition
Other synonyms of adherence include adhesiveness, bond.
